Rheumatoid arthritis - This type of arthritis is actually an autoimmune disease in which the body's immune system attacks the joints. It usually shows up in a mirror-image pattern, so, for instance, both big toe joints would be affected at the same time. Those with this disease often experience periods of remission in between flare-ups. Women are much more likely than men to develop RA. A neuroma is a collection of nerve endings (usually between the 3rd and 4th toe) where their coverings have become inflamed. There is a burning sensation that's like an electric tingling or shooting pain; accompanied by numbness. Even though there is no swelling or lumps, the pain can be pretty bad. Diagnosis is done with medical history and physical examination. The heel is the largest bone in the foot. Heel pain is the most common foot problem and affects two million Americans every year. It can occur in the front, back, or bottom of the heel. Bursitis of the Heel. Bursitis of the heel is an inflammation of the bursa, a small sack of fluid tissue, beneath the heel bone. Tarsal Tunnel Syndrome. Tarsal tunnel syndrome results from compression to a nerve that runs through a narrow passage behind the inner ankle bone down to the heel. It is caused by injury to the ankle, such as a sprain or fracture, or by a growth that presses against the nerve. Treatment for Bursitis. NSAIDs and steroid injections will help relieve pain from bursitis. Applying ice and massaging the heel is also beneficial. A heel cup or soft padding in the heel of the shoe will reduce direct impact when walking. Treatment for Tarsal Tunnel Syndrome. Pain from tarsal tunnel syndrome may be relieved by treatment with orthotics, specially designed shoe inserts, to help redistribute weight and take pressure off the nerve. Corticosteroid injections may also help. Surgery is sometimes performed to relieve pressure on the nerve, but unfortunately, studies are showing that this surgery is often not beneficial. There are many different factors that can lead to arch pain. Often arch pain can result from a direct cause such as a foot injury or a structural imbalance of the foot, such as flat feet or a low or high arch. However, the most frequent cause of arch pain is a common condition known as plantar fasciitis. The most common symptoms of arch pain are tenderness and pain in the arch region of the foot. Plantar fasciitis is a painful foot condition which can strike any part of the underside of the foot between the heel and the toes. The condition affects a structure called the plantar fascia, which is a band of fibrous tissue which connects the heel to the ball of the foot. Its function is to support the foot arch and help hold the foot's shape. It has been estimated that the structure carries as much as 14% of the load of the foot, so it is no surprise that it is prone to injury.
